Transaction 407040e248f97ab914a966690af9cf628dfd54bdce620712628fe36746db238a

1 Input
2 Outputs
  • 407040e248f97ab914a966690af9cf628dfd54bdce620712628fe36746db238a:0
  • value  2742277
    address  1Drzcf7DVNSBY5JeK6SyLaQ2KntKjmQ6dx
  • 407040e248f97ab914a966690af9cf628dfd54bdce620712628fe36746db238a:1
  • value  128551534
    address  32MJd1y9qTSR7pSSJh3vHKPWM7wdCjwWxy